Merge "Fix for F/C in WifiConfigInfo"
diff --git a/src/com/android/settings/wifi/WifiConfigInfo.java b/src/com/android/settings/wifi/WifiConfigInfo.java
index 2ed4f02..9b680a8 100644
--- a/src/com/android/settings/wifi/WifiConfigInfo.java
+++ b/src/com/android/settings/wifi/WifiConfigInfo.java
@@ -31,15 +31,9 @@
*/
public class WifiConfigInfo extends Activity {
- private static final String TAG = "WifiConfigInfo";
-
private TextView mConfigList;
private WifiManager mWifiManager;
- //============================
- // Activity lifecycle
- //============================
-
@Override
protected void onCreate(Bundle savedInstanceState) {
super.onCreate(savedInstanceState);
@@ -52,12 +46,16 @@
@Override
protected void onResume() {
super.onResume();
- final List<WifiConfiguration> wifiConfigs = mWifiManager.getConfiguredNetworks();
- StringBuffer configList = new StringBuffer();
- for (int i = wifiConfigs.size() - 1; i >= 0; i--) {
- configList.append(wifiConfigs.get(i));
+ if (mWifiManager.isWifiEnabled()) {
+ final List<WifiConfiguration> wifiConfigs = mWifiManager.getConfiguredNetworks();
+ StringBuffer configList = new StringBuffer();
+ for (int i = wifiConfigs.size() - 1; i >= 0; i--) {
+ configList.append(wifiConfigs.get(i));
+ }
+ mConfigList.setText(configList);
+ } else {
+ mConfigList.setText(R.string.wifi_state_disabled);
}
- mConfigList.setText(configList);
}
}